Volunteer Hospice Remembrance Ceremony (Feb. 10)

SEQUIM – Anyone who has lost a loved one, whether recently or further in the past, is welcome to join Volunteer Hospice of Clallam County at its annual Remembrance Ceremony scheduled for Saturday, Feb. 10, at 2 p.m. at Trinity United Methodist Church, 100 Blake Ave in Sequim.

The event will include the reading of lost loved ones’ names, a candle-lighting ceremony and a group address. After, attendees may gather in the church’s Fellowship Hall for refreshments and to visit.

Registration is not required, and candles will be provided.

If anyone would like to add a loved one’s name to the list to be read aloud or would like more information, they may email office@vhocc.org or phone 360-452-1511.

Names may also be added upon arrival at the church.

The Remembrance Ceremony is a part of VHOCC’s Soul Care program.
